A blue and white Transitional brush pot, 17th Century, Chenghua mark

609

Lot 609. A blue and white Transitional brush pot, 17th Century, Chenghua mark. Height 13 cm. Estimate 2 694 € / 2 887 €. Lot sold 3 810 €. © Bukowskis

This slightly waisted brush pot – being one centimetre wider at the glazed rim than at the base – is decorated in a vibrant under glaze blue. The glaze on the outside is more shiny and smooth than that on the inside - suggesting the application of two different glazes. There is a shallow groove to the foot rim of the pot and the glazed base has an apocryphal six-character Chenghua mark.

Note: The scene is thought to be as that described in Part I/Act II of “The Romance of the Western Chamber” – referred to as “The Renting of the Quarters in the Monastery”.
